Android Engineer

at  Ford Motor Company

Naucalpan, Méx., Mexico -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ate27 Nov, 2024Not Specified31 Aug, 20242 year(s) or aboveIntegration,Technology Services,Customer Engagement,Cloud Services,Mobile Apps,Rework,Sonarqube,Platforms,Firebase,Code,Communication Skills,Infrastructure,Apps,CloudN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Ford Credit IT is looking for a proficient Android Mobile Engineer who is having excellent hands-on in Mobile app Development using Android Native with Kotlin, Jetpack Compose.

  • Strong knowledge on dependencies.
  • Strong knowledge on Coroutines.
  • Good understanding of the various design patterns in Android Native application.
  • Strong knowledge on debugging and other tools available for the Android Developer ecosystem.
  • Able to understand the existing code and provide appropriate solutions for feature additions which adheres to the standards and guidelines.
  • Knowledge on Accessibility with respect to Android.
  • Highly proficient in object-oriented principles.
  • Solid understanding of Jetpack Compose UI and the entire lifecycle.
  • Ability to understand the stories and features and come up with the appropriate low-level design.
  • Able to work with the respective leads and anchors to address priority items lined up for the release.
  • Ability to understand the various integration touchpoints that provides insights on the App stability like Crashlytics,Dynatrace,Mixpanel etc.
  • Deep knowledge on the Android design principles and human interface guidelines.
  • Strong knowledge on State,View transition and navigation patterns in Android.
  • Engage in Agile practices including but not limited to Stand-ups, backlog grooming, sprint demos and journey mapping.
  • Good communication skills.
  • Ability to peer review code as per the standards set and help junior developers in following the same.
  • Strong knowledge on code versioning tools like GIT.
  • Good understanding of Unit testing implementation of the Android and Kotlin ecosystem using Default or Thirdparty frameworks.

POSITION QUALIFICATIONS:

  • B.E. / B.Tech / M.C.A
  • Minimum 4-7 years of experience developing mobile apps with Native Android.
  • Must have experience in deploying apps to the stores using automated scripts.
  • Lead overall Mobile development from Engineering team and able to collaborate with cross functional teams based on the module being worked upon.
  • Ability to integrate with various customer engagement and analytics platform.
  • Ability to understand and create appropriate configuration on those platforms.
  • Ability to integrate the GraphQL from Native Mobile app.
  • Demonstrated ability to drive development of highly technical technology services and capabilities.
  • Experience with push notification solutions others than Firebase would be preferred.
  • Strong sense of code with ability to review code using SonarQube, Check Marx, rework and deliver Quality code.

NICE TO HAVE SKILLS:

  • 2+ years of experience in integration with fault highly scalable platforms that consumes cloud API/REST/GraphQL(Pub/Sub).
  • Should have knowledge on basic cloud services and infrastructure as a code.
  • Ability to work in team in diverse/ multiple stakeholder environment.
  • Experience and desire to work in a Global delivery environment.
  • Excellent communication skills with the ability to adapt your communication style to the audience.
  • Demonstrated ability to work on robust and fast paced environment targeting a major transformation.
  • Knowledge on platforms listed below or similar capabilities.
    o Medallia
    o Optimizely
    o Content Square
    o Branch.io

Responsibilities:

Please refer the Job description for details


REQUIREMENT SUMMARY

Min:2.0Max:7.0 year(s)

Information Technology/IT

IT Software - Mobile

Software Engineering

B.Tech

Proficient

1

Naucalpan, Méx., Mexico